Watchdogs on the Hill : The Decline of Congressional Oversight of U.S. Foreign Relations /

An essential responsibility of the U.S. Congress is holding the president accountable for the conduct of foreign policy. In this in-depth look at formal oversight hearings by the Senate Armed Services and Foreign Relations committees, Linda Fowler evaluates how the legislature's most visible an...
